Abstract
BACKGROUND Current guidelines for sigmoid volvulus recommend endoscopy as a first line of treatment for decompression, followed by colectomy as early as possible. Timing of the latter varies greatly. This study compared early (≤2 days) versus delayed (>2 days) sigmoid colectomy. METHODS 2016-2019 NRD database was queried to identify patients aged ≥65 years admitted for sigmoid volvulus who underwent sequential endoscopic decompression and sigmoid colectomy. Outcomes included mortality, complications, hospital length of stay, readmissions, and hospital costs. RESULTS 842 patients were included, of which 409 (48.6 %) underwent delayed sigmoid colectomy. Delayed sigmoid colectomy was associated with reduced cardiac complications (1.1 % vs 0.0 %, p = 0.045), reduced ostomy rate (38.3 % vs 29.4 %, p = 0.013), an increased overall length of stay (12 days vs 8 days, p < 0.001) and increased overall costs (27,764 dollar vs. 24,472 dollar, p < 0.001). CONCLUSION In geriatric patient with sigmoid volvulus, delayed surgical resection after decompression is associated with reduced cardiac complications and reduced ostomy rate, while increasing overall hospital length of stay and costs.

Abstract
Background Endoscopic treatment is the first-line therapy for uncomplicated sigmoid volvulus (SV). However, there are few reports on the clinical course of SV. We investigated the clinical courses of successful and unsuccessful endoscopic detorsions for bowel decompression in patients with uncomplicated SV. Methods Between May 2009 and February 2022, patients with uncomplicated SV who underwent endoscopic detorsion or decompression only if detorsion failed were enrolled. A case analysis (all cases) and a patient analysis (first episode cases) were performed. Outcomes were compared between the detorsion and decompression groups, including length of hospital stay, recurrence rate, and days to readmission due to SV. Results Seventy patients were included in this study. The success rate of endoscopic detorsion of the SV was 28.6%. There were no differences in age, sex, or other characteristics between the two groups. The hospital stay tended to be longer in the decompression group than in the detorsion group. However, there was no difference in the 30-day, 6-month, or 12-month recurrence rate or the number of days to readmission for SV between the two groups in the case and patient analyses. Conclusions This study suggests that endoscopic decompression is a feasible alternative to endoscopic detorsion in patients with uncomplicated SV.

Abstract
AIM Sigmoid volvulus is a challenging condition, and deciding between elective surgery or expectant management can be complex. The aim of this study was to develop a tool for predicting the risk of recurrent sigmoid volvulus and all-cause mortality within 1 year following initial nonoperative management. METHOD This is a retrospective cohort study using Medicare claims data from 2016 to 2018 of beneficiaries admitted urgently/emergently for volvulus, undergoing colonic decompression and discharged alive without surgery (excluding those discharged to hospice). The primary outcomes were recurrent sigmoid volvulus and all-cause mortality within 1 year. Proportional hazards models and logistic regression were employed to identify risk factors and develop prediction equations, which were subsequently validated. RESULTS Among the 2078 patients managed nonoperatively, 36.1% experienced recurrent sigmoid volvulus and 28.6% died within 1 year. The prediction model for recurrence integrated age, sex, race, palliative care consultations and four comorbidities, achieving area under the curve values of 0.63 in both the training and testing samples. The model for mortality incorporated age, palliative care consultations and nine comorbidities, with area under the curve values of 0.76 in the training and 0.70 in the testing sample. CONCLUSION This study provides a straightforward predictive tool that utilizes easily accessible data to estimate individualized risks of recurrent sigmoid volvulus and all-cause mortality for older adults initially managed nonoperatively. The tool can assist clinicians and patients in making informed decisions about such risks. While the accuracy of the calculator was validated, further confirmation through external validation and prospective studies would enhance its clinical utility.

Abstract
BACKGROUND Recurrent sigmoid volvulus is frequent and sometimes occurs in frail patients with contraindications to surgical sigmoidectomy. Percutaneous endoscopic sigmoidopexy (PES) has recently been proposed as an alternative to elective sigmoidectomy. We aimed to describe the efficacy and safety of PES. METHODS All consecutive patients who underwent PES for recurrent sigmoid volvulus at two French centers between January 2017 and March 2021 were included in this retrospective case series. Recurrent sigmoid volvulus was defined as at least two symptomatic episodes treated by endoscopic decompression. Under endoscopic guidance, anchors were placed to attach the sigmoid to the anterior abdominal wall, allowing the placement of pigtail Chait catheters. RESULTS 15 patients (60 % female; median age 74 years [range 49-96]) were included. Median number of previous sigmoid volvulus episodes was 3 (range 2-6). Procedures were technically successful with no intraprocedural adverse events for 14 patients (93 %). Peritonitis occurred at Day 2 in one patient (serious adverse event rate 7 %). Median follow-up time was 10 months (range 1-30). No sigmoid volvulus recurrence occurred during follow-up. CONCLUSION PES using Chait catheters was feasible and effective for recurrent sigmoid volvulus and should be considered as an alternative to sigmoidectomy in inoperable patients.

Abstract
BACKGROUND Volvulus is one of the leading causes of colonic obstruction with a high recurrence rate following endoscopic decompression. Although colonic resection remains the treatment of choice, it is often associated with significant morbidity and mortality, especially in elderly patients. Colonic fixation with extra-peritonealization has been suggested as an alternative to colonic resection. The aim of this study was to evaluate the surgical outcomes of patients with colonic volvulus in our initial experience with this procedure. METHODS A retrospective analysis of a prospectively maintained database of all patients who underwent colonic extra-peritonealization for volvulus between January 2016 and April 2021 in Sheba medical center (Ramat-Gan, Israel) was performed. Patients' demographics, clinical, peri-operative and post-operative data were recorded and analyzed. RESULTS One hundred and thirty nine patients were admitted due to acute colonic volvulus, 48 of whom were treated surgically. Eleven patients underwent extra-peritonealization of the sigmiod or cecum during the study period. Mean age was 64.5 years. Six patients (54.55%) were males. Seven patients (63.63%) presented with sigmoid volvulus and 4 (36.36%) with cecal volvulus. Median American Society of Anesthesiologists (ASA) class was 3 (range 2-4). One patient (9.09%) was required urgent surgery. The majority of patients was operated on using a laparoscopic approach (10 patients, 90.9%). Median length of stay was 3 days (range 1-6 days) and no post-operative complications or readmissions within 30 days after surgery were recorded. Median length of follow-up was 283 days (range 21-777 days). During the follow-up period, three patients (27.27%) presented with recurrent volvulus and required an additional surgical intervention with colonic resection. Of the patients with volvulus recurrence, one patient (9.09%) required an urgent surgical intervention. CONCLUSIONS Extra-peritonealization of colonic volvulus is feasible and safe. Although recurrence rates are fairly high, the low morbidity associated with the procedure makes it an appealing alternative to colonic resection, especially in patients with high risk for post-operative complications.

Abstract
Background Sigmoid volvulus is a common cause of emergency surgical admission. Those patients are often treated conservatively with a high rate of recurrence. We wondered if a more aggressive management might be indicated.
Methods We have reviewed data of patients diagnosed with acute sigmoid volvulus over a 2-year period. The primary endpoint was patient survival.
Results We analysed 332 admissions of 78 patients. 39.7% underwent resection. Survival was 54.9 ± 8.8 months from the first hospitalization, irrespective of the treatment. Long-term survival was positively influenced by being female, having a low “social score”, a younger age and surgery. Multivariate analysis showed that only being female and surgery were independently associated with better survival.
Conclusion Early surgery may be the best approach in patients with recurrent sigmoid volvulus, as it ensures longer survival with a better quality of life, regardless of the patient’s social and functional condition.

Abstract
Purpose To analyze the treatment outcomes for sigmoid volvulus (SV) and identify risk factors of complications and mortality. Methods Observational study of all consecutive adult patients diagnosed with SV who were admitted from January 2000 to December 2020 in a tertiary university institution for conservative management, urgent or elective surgery. Primary outcomes were 30-day postoperative morbidity, mortality and 2-year overall survival (OS), including analysis of risk factors for postoperative morbidity or mortality and prognostic factors for 2-year OS. Results A total of 92 patients were included. Conservative management was performed in 43 cases (46.7%), 27 patients (29.4%) underwent emergent surgery and 22 (23.9%) were scheduled for elective surgery. Successful decompression was achieved in 87.8% of cases, but the recurrence rate was 47.2%. Mortality rates following episodes were higher for conservative treatment than for urgent or elective surgery (37.2%, 22.2%, 9.1%, respectively; p = 0.044). ASA score > III was an independent risk factor for complications (OR = 5.570, 95% CI = 1.740–17.829, p < 0.001) and mortality (OR = 6.139, 95% CI = 2.629–14.335, p < 0.001) in the 30 days after admission. Patients who underwent elective surgery showed higher 2-year OS than those with conservative treatment (p = 0.011). Elective surgery (HR = 2.604, 95% CI = 1.185–5.714, p = 0.017) and ASA score > III (HR = 0.351, 95% CI = 0.192–0.641, p = 0.001) were independent prognostic factors for 2-year OS. Conclusion Successful endoscopic decompression can be achieved in most SV patients, but with the drawbacks of high recurrence, morbidity and mortality rates. Concurrent severe comorbidities and conservative treatment were independent prognostic factors for morbidity and survival in SV.

Abstract
Background: Sigmoid volvulus (SV) is the twisting of the sigmoid colon around itself. Endoscopy both helps diagnosis and provides treatment in the absence of peritonitis or perforation in SV. Nevertheless, there are some controversies or limitations on this subject. The aim of this study is to evaluate the current role of the endoscopic decompression in the treatment of SV. Materials and Methods: The clinical records of 1040 patients with SV treated over a 55-year period from June 1966 to July 2021 were reviewed retrospectively until June 1986 and prospectively thereafter. For each case, preoperational parameters, treatment options, and prognosis were noted. Results: Endoscopic decompression was tried in 748 patients (71.9%). The procedure was successful in 585 cases (83.2%), whereas unsuccessful in 118 (16.8%) of 703 patients (94.0%) with viable bowel. The mortality rate was 0.5% (4 patients), the morbidity rate was 1.9% (14 patients), the early recurrence rate was 5.5% (32 patients), whereas the mean hospitalization period was 34.6 hours (range: 24-96 hours). Conclusions: Despite some controversies or limitations in some subjects including the strategy in ischemic or gangrenous cases, the factors affecting the success, kind of the used instruments, technical details of the application, role of the flatus tubes, and the specific topics such as SV in childhood or pregnancy, endoscopic decompression is the first-line therapy in selected patients with SV.

Abstract
Purpose This study aimed to evaluate real-world clinical outcomes from surgically treated patients for sigmoid volvulus. Methods Five tertiary centers participated in this retrospective study with data collected from October 2003 through September 2018, including demographic information, preoperative clinical data, and information on laparoscopic/open and elective/emergency procedures. Outcome measurements included operation time, postoperative hospitalization, and postoperative morbidity. Results Among 74 patients, sigmoidectomy was the most common procedure (n = 46), followed by Hartmann’s procedure (n = 23), and subtotal colectomy (n = 5). Emergency surgery was performed in 35 cases (47.3%). Of the 35 emergency patients, 34 cases (97.1%) underwent open surgery, and a stoma was established for 26 patients (74.3%). Elective surgery was performed in 39 cases (52.7%), including 21 open procedures (53.8%), and 18 laparoscopic surgeries (46.2%). Median laparoscopic operation time was 180 minutes, while median open surgery time was 130 minutes (P < 0.001). Median postoperative hospitalization was 11 days for laparoscopy and 12 days for open surgery. There were 20 postoperative complications (27.0%), and all were resolved with conservative management. Emergency surgery cases had a higher complication rate than elective surgery cases (40.0% vs. 15.4%, P = 0.034). Conclusion Relative to elective surgery, emergency surgery had a higher rate of postoperative complications, open surgery, and stoma formation. As such, elective laparoscopic surgery after successful sigmoidoscopic decompression may be the optimal clinical option.

Abstract
Colonic volvulus and acute colonic pseudo-obstruction (ACPO) are 2 causes of benign large-bowel obstruction. Colonic volvulus occurs most commonly in the sigmoid colon as a result of bowel twisting along its mesenteric axis. In contrast, the exact pathophysiology of ACPO is poorly understood, with the prevailing hypothesis being altered regulation of colonic function by the autonomic nervous system resulting in colonic distention in the absence of mechanical blockage. Prompt diagnosis and intervention leads to improved outcomes for both diagnoses. Endoscopy may play a role in the evaluation and management of both entities. The purpose of this document from the American Society for Gastrointestinal Endoscopy's Standards of Practice Committee is to provide an update on the evaluation and endoscopic management of sigmoid volvulus and ACPO.
